Carnelian is a variety of chalcedony, which is a form of microcrystalline quartz. It is known for its red, orange or reddish-brown colour due to the presence of iron oxide. Colours can range from very pale to very intense, and it is often translucent.
In history, carnelian has been used since ancient times, prized for its beauty and worn as a semi-precious stone. Ancient Egyptians, for example, used carnelian in jewellery and decorative objects, and associated it with protection and inner peace. It was also believed to give courage and vital energy to its wearer.
